次の方法で共有


EncoderParameterValueType 列挙型

定義

イメージの Save メソッドまたは SaveAdd メソッドで使用される EncoderParameter のデータ型を指定します。

public enum class EncoderParameterValueType
public enum EncoderParameterValueType
type EncoderParameterValueType = 
Public Enum EncoderParameterValueType
継承
EncoderParameterValueType

フィールド

ValueTypeAscii 2

8 ビットの ASCII 値。 このフィールドは、値の配列が null で終わる ASCII 文字列であることを指定します。

ValueTypeByte 1

8 ビット符号なし整数。

ValueTypeLong 4

32 ビット符号なし整数

ValueTypeLongRange 6

整数値の範囲を指定する 2 つの long 値。 1 つ目の値では下限を指定し、2 つ目の値では上限を指定します。 すべての値は、両端の値の範囲に含まれます。

ValueTypePointer 9

カスタム メタデータのブロックへのポインター。

ValueTypeRational 5

32 ビット符号なし整数のペア。 それぞれのペアは分数を表し、最初の整数は分子、2 番目の整数は分母です。

ValueTypeRationalRange 8

4 つの 32 ビット符号なし整数のセット。 最初の 2 つの整数は 1 つの分数を表し、次の 2 つの整数はもう 1 つの分数を表します。

2 つの分数は、有理数の範囲を表します。 最初の分数は範囲内の最小の有理数であり、2 番目の分数は範囲内の最大の有理数です。 値は、両端の値の範囲に含まれます。

ValueTypeShort 3

16 ビットの符号なし整数。

ValueTypeUndefined 7

データ型が定義されていないバイト。 変数は、フィールド定義に応じて任意の値を受け取ることができます。

注釈

GDI+ では、イメージ エンコーダーを使用して、オブジェクトに Bitmap 格納されているイメージをさまざまなファイル形式に変換します。 イメージ エンコーダーは、BMP、JPEG、GIF、TIFF、PNG 形式の GDI+ に組み込まれています。 オブジェクトの または SaveAdd メソッドを呼び出すと、エンコーダーがBitmap呼び出Saveされます。

オブジェクトのデータ メンバーは NumberOfValuesEncoderParameter ターミネータを含む null 文字列の長さを示します。

適用対象

こちらもご覧ください